How they compare
Europe currently reports 0.0245 kt against 0.0088 kt in Russian Federation, a difference of 0.0157 kt.
That makes Europe's figure about 2.8 times Russian Federation's.
Across all 32 years both countries report, Europe has been ahead every year.
Europe ranks 3rd and Russian Federation ranks 2nd of 23 regions.
Europe has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Europe | Russian Federation |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.0258 kt | 0.0028 kt | 0.023 kt | Europe |
| 2000s | 0.0237 kt | 0.0028 kt | 0.0209 kt | Europe |
| 2010s | 0.0248 kt | 0.0046 kt | 0.0201 kt | Europe |
| 2020s | 0.0253 kt | 0.0079 kt | 0.0174 kt | Europe |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
